SIG Sauer P226 Elite 40 S&W
The P226 Elite chambered in .40 S&W delivers the Elite's short reset trigger and beavertail package with the proven .40 S&W cartridge. All-steel construction and the longer P226 grip frame give it better felt recoil management than compact .40 pistols. A standard configuration for law enforcement agencies that issued the .40 S&W during the FBI-led .40 adoption wave.
